    Dodgers Reliever Daniel Hudson Announces Retirement Moments After 2024 World Series Win

    October 31, 20243 Mins Read


    Daniel Hudson: In a dramatic conclusion to a storied career, Los Angeles Dodgers relief pitcher Daniel Hudson announced his retirement shortly after the Dodgers clinched the 2024 World Series title with a 7-6 victory over the New York Yankees in Game 5. The 37-year-old Hudson, a veteran of 15 Major League Baseball seasons, shared with reporters that he had returned to the game this season solely to chase another World Series ring and retire “on top.”

    “This was the only reason I came back — to go out on top,” Hudson said in an emotional post-game interview. “And that’s what’s happening.”

    Hudson’s decision marks the end of a distinguished career spanning more than a decade and including stints with multiple MLB teams, among them the Chicago White Sox, Arizona Diamondbacks, Pittsburgh Pirates, Toronto Blue Jays, Washington Nationals, Tampa Bay Rays, and San Diego Padres. Despite not pitching in Game 5, Hudson warmed up during the game and would have become the first player in MLB history to close out World Series victories for two different teams if he had taken the mound. In 2019, Hudson famously secured the final out for the Washington Nationals in their World Series win over the Houston Astros, earning his first championship ring.

    Daniel Hudson’s Remarkable Career Highlights

    Hudson retires with a career ERA of 3.74, a testament to his reliability on the mound. His impressive 2.95 strikeout-to-walk ratio across 547 appearances underscored his consistent ability to control the game. Recognized for his versatility and skill, Hudson leaves behind a legacy of 7.7 Wins Above Replacement (WAR), as calculated by Baseball Reference. A one-time Silver Slugger Award recipient, Hudson was known for his powerful pitches and calm demeanor under pressure.
